يونس · Verse 35 / 109 · Page 213
ۖ ۗ ۚ قُلْ هَلْ مِن شُرَكَائِكُم مَّن يَهْدِي إِلَى الْحَقِّ قُلِ اللَّهُ يَهْدِي لِلْحَقِّ أَفَمَن يَهْدِي إِلَى الْحَقِّ أَحَقُّ أَن يُتَّبَعَ أَمَّن لَّا يَهِدِّي إِلَّا أَن يُهْدَى فَمَا لَكُمْ كَيْفَ تَحْكُمُونَ
Qul hal min shurakaaa 'ikum mai yahdeee ilal haqq; qulil laahu yahdee lilhaqq; afamai yahdeee ilal haqqi ahaqqu ai yuttaba'a ammal laa yahiddeee illaaa ai yuhdaa famaa lakum kaifa tahkumoon
Say, "Are there of your 'partners' any who guides to the truth?" Say, "Allah guides to the truth. So is He who guides to the truth more worthy to be followed or he who guides not unless he is guided? Then what is [wrong] with you - how do you judge?"
Say to them O messenger: 'Is there are any of their ‘partners’ who they worship beside Allah, one who guides to the truth? Is He Who guides people to the truth and calls them to it more worthy of being followed, or your so-called gods which cannot guide themselves unless they are guided? What is wrong with you that you judge so falsely, claiming that they are ‘partners’ to Allah? Allah is far above what you say.'
